We're just finalizing some of the IntelliSense features which will be in beta 2 of our new Flex IDE, Amethyst.
Being a long-time Visual Studio user, I would find it very hard indeed to program without good IntelliSense. We have previously developed an IntelliSense system for the Ruby language - which was really hard work bearing in mind that Ruby doesn't even have type declarations, and a single Ruby identifier can change its type from one line of code to the next.
